What we offer

As the Builder you oversee the timely construction of each home from carpentry to warranty service request signoff, while ensuring high quality results, within budget and striving to provide The Best Homeowner Experience. You are responsible for producing zero defect homes through effective management of trades, suppliers and staff. You will coordinate the various complex aspects of the construction process while maintaining the high standards and integrity of Mattamy. You act as the primary representative of company on construction matters to homeowners and maintains an aesthetically appealing, safe worksite and professional and efficient work environment.

What you’ll do

  • Ensures complete adherence to Mattamy Construction Processes, in accordance with Policy and Procedures.
  • Accountable for managing the construction of assigned homes from foundation to warranty servicerequest signoff.
  • Monitors all daily trade functions:timeliness, quality of workmanship and completion of work.
  • Walks all homeson a daily basis to ensure imperfections are noted, Building Code is adhered to, and Homebuyers Options and Extras are complied with.Adheres to procedures as required by the trade Scopes of Work and Mattamy Quality Standards and takes corrective action as necessary.
  • Conducts a detailed frame check on each unit prior to drywall, in accordance with Mattamy Policy and Procedures, and follows up to ensure the timely completion of any items noted.
  • Schedules and conducts homeowner frame walk.
  • Responsible forsupervising on-site construction staff, including the scheduling of subcontractors, inspectors and suppliers on the job.
  • Resolves day-to-day problems on the job site, inspecting all work during construction to ensure compliance with plans and specifications, and resolving construction problems.
  • Approves subcontractor invoice for quality and quantity before issuing Completion Slip.
  • Assists in ordering all materials required to construct houses.
  • Continuously trains and mentors staff.
  • Reinforces and educatesthe importance of schedule adherence (and assists where trade availability is causing difficulty), unwavering focus on Mattamy mission, and safety and quality standards.
  • Communicates and coordinates activities with other staff (Site and Head Office) to ensure smooth production operation.
  • Schedules and attends all necessary municipal inspections.Assists Inspectors with the completion of the review, and rectifies issues as required.
  • Responsible for managing the ProductionSchedule andupdating it no less than weekly.Adds comments regarding site changes and improvements asnecessary andcommunicates to Senior Builder.
  • Ensures all work is being done in a safe manner and enforces safety standards and laws within positions scope of authority.
  • Ensures homes are as clean and aesthetically appealing as possible while under construction.

What you bring

  • A minimum of 4 years residential construction management experience in the new home industry.
  • Post-secondaryeducation/community college in a related field (Construction Engineering Technology)
  • Extensive knowledge of Alberta Building Code, Occupational Health and Safety Act, and other health and safety regulations.
  • Clear understanding of contracts, plans, and specifications, as well as construction methods, materials, and regulations. Includes knowledge of all trades, staff responsibilities, scheduling, and scopes of work.
  • Excellent Customer Service skills.
  • Strong organizational skills, including tracking and control of costs and budgets.
  • Must be detailed and thorough.
  • Ability to train and mentorstaff through advanced leadership skills with the ability to delegate as required.
  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ills required, both oral and written.Willing to take responsibility and be held accountable for results.
  • Skills in building relationships with a broad network of contacts, including trade partners and suppliers and a strong customer focus.
  • Proficient withMS Office software; knowledge ofBuildPro or another ERP platforman asset.

Who we are

Mattamy Homes is the largest family-owned homebuilder in North America, with 40-plus years of history across Canada and the United States. Every year, Mattamy helps more than 8,000 families realize their dream of home ownership. In Canada, our communities stretch across the Greater Toronto Area as well as in Ottawa, Calgary and Edmonton.
